New Rules Would Cut Emissions From Buses, Big Rigs

2015-06-19 19:02:00| Climate Ark Climate Change & Global Warming Newsfeed

Climate Central: Big rigs and other medium- and heavy-duty trucks plying U.S. highways may become much more fuel efficient if new rules proposed on Friday by the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ency are finalized. The rules, submitted as part of the Obama administration's Climate Action Plan, seek to increase the fuel efficiency of big rigs, cut U.S. carbon dioxide emissions by 1 billion metric tons and reduce crude oil consumption by 1.8 billion barrels as a way to reduce the transportation sector's impact on...
